Cisive has an employee rating of 2.8 out of 5 stars, based on 258 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Cisive employee rating is 25% below average for employers within the Management & Consulting indust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

Lots of opportunity to learn. Long company history of success. Many really great people. Decent options for Health, Dental, Vision, Insurance, Retirement. Providing much needed services. Recent decisions have obviously been made to ensure continued profitability. Unlimited PTO

Cons

Mostly outsourced HR & a mostly remote workforce means little direction that helps ensure company policies are met, people feel valued or answers/communication is sometimes incorrect/incomplete & often slow to receive. Health insurance is "Self funded" though administered by a 3rd party, but that means they may exclude some types of services that traditional health insurance may cover. Unlimited PTO sounds great, but it can be difficult to schedule & stick to because of the fast pace of the business. No employee resource/affinity groups.
